Problem: Bash core dumps after adding 3-4 postings in row to the blog in FreeBSD 6.2. I can reproduce it on two different machines. If I'm using Bash 2, it runs without any problem.
It happens after the last steps, updating cache and so on. Any hint? I doubt it's FreeBSD specifix, maybe the script triggers a bug in the latest Bash?

I'm not familiar with how FreeBSD is setup, but it sounds to me like you might be hitting some kind of resource limitation imposed on the shell like ulimit. What do you see when you enter "ulimit -a" in Bash?
Please include the exact versions of Nanoblogger and Bash 2 in your next response.
